<p>PURPOSE:To realize a desired temperature while eliminating effects of temperature and obtain favorable image quality at the time of recording a multi-gradational image, by providing a temperature-detecting means and a recording signal controlling part for varying a recording signal according to the temperature information detected by the temperature detecting means. CONSTITUTION:In an image printer for forming a monochromic image on a photographic printing paper, a monochromic photographic printing paper with a gamma of 1.5 is used as a photosensitive material 102, and a fluorescent tube having a fluorescence wavelength in a high-sensitity region of the material 102 is used as a light source 101. When an image signal 108 is inputted to the image printer, a controlling part 109 calculates a control signal corresponding to the density level of each picture element on an image on the basis of the image signal 108, performs correction for eliminating the effects of the temperature of an optical shutter array, and generates a signal for designating the position of the image. The control signal outputted by the controlling part 109 applies a voltage according to the density level of the image to each shutter part 107 of the shutter array 106, thereby controlling the quantity of light transmitted through the shutter part 107. Thus, characters or images can be recorded on the material 102 while expressing multiple gradations with a high contrast ratio for each pixel.</p> |
